Family-specific differences

When evaluating dining options for families, the differences extend beyond the menu. Porfirio's Cancún | Restaurante de comida mexicana presents a polished environment, often with live music or a DJ, creating a sophisticated backdrop. This contrasts sharply with family-focused establishments that might offer high chairs, booster seats, or even small play areas.

The seating at Porfirio's is designed for comfort and conversation among adults, not necessarily for containing energetic toddlers. While the staff is professional, their primary focus is on delivering a high-end dining experience, not on entertaining children. Portions are crafted for adult appetites and presentation, meaning a child's meal might need to be ordered off-menu or adapted from an adult dish, if at all possible.

Restaurants like Bubba Gump Shrimp Co. Cancún, for example, are built around a family-friendly concept, with themed decor and menu items specifically appealing to younger diners, a stark contrast to the elegant setting of Porfirio's.

Which suits which ages

Which suits which ages

Porfirio's Cancún | Restaurante de comida mexicana is best suited for families with older teenagers, perhaps 15 and up, who appreciate a more adult dining experience. These older children might enjoy the sophisticated atmosphere, the quality of the Mexican cuisine, and the overall buzz of the restaurant.

For families with tweens, say 10 to 14, it could be a hit or miss depending on their individual maturity and palate. They might find the food interesting, but the lack of overt entertainment could lead to restlessness. Toddlers and younger children, generally under 10, are unlikely to enjoy the experience.

The noise level, the longer dining times, and the absence of kid-centric options make it a challenging environment for them. For these younger age groups, alternatives like Cafe Antoinette Xpuhil or Marakame Cancún, with their more relaxed settings and broader menu appeal, would be a more comfortable fit.

Local knowledge

Evening Crowds

Many upscale restaurants in the Hotel Zone, including Porfirio's, become very busy after 8 PM, especially on weekends. Earlier dinner times can offer a slightly calmer atmosphere.

Dress Code

While not strictly enforced with jackets, a smart casual dress code is generally expected at establishments like Porfirio's Cancún. Avoid beachwear or overly casual attire to feel comfortable.

Tipping Culture

In Cancun, a standard tip for good service at sit-down restaurants is 15-20%. Be aware that some establishments might automatically add a service charge, so check your bill.
